Pale ale that will stop at nothing to crush all competition. Hit hard with Motueka and Citra hops with lesser amounts of Simcoe and Mosaic.

50 IBUs

On tap at Cellarmaker Brewing

A: Pours golden amber with a creamy off white head that settles to a light layer and laces well.

S: slightly dank, citrus, light tropical fruit, and a little caramel malt sweetness.

T: Bright citrus, lemon lime, tropical fruit, passion fruit, faint herbal notes, and a little light caramel malt sweetness.

M: Medium body, moderate carbonation, very smooth.

O: Cellarmaker has this style of pale ale dialed in. Quite nice.
